hey guys, i am going to do my 20k service this thurs.
do i need to do change my tyres?
is there a need to do so?
and do i need to switch tyre and do the balancing and alignment?
Changing tyres is subjective. Your tyre can last longer if u rarely drive the car and its under shade most of the time thus avoiding heat which creates cracks in your tyre. If u drive often then wear on the tyre is greater hence needing to change quicker than a car that is driven lesser. About alignment, its suggested by SC to to rotation, alignment and balancing every 10k which means your car would have done once before and its time for the 2nd time. Some people do it every 5k as they pointed out that they usually drive on bumpy roads and the alignment goes out quicker than a car that zooms on a smooth highway.
